What is Contour Face Powder?

Contour face powder is a cosmetic product designed to enhance the natural structure of your face. By adding depth and dimension, it shapes and defines the features, such as cheekbones, jawline, and nose. The key to an effective contour is the use of shades that mimic shadow and highlight, allowing for a more sculpted look.

Benefits of Using Contour Face Powder

1. Defines Facial Features

One of the primary advantages of contour face powder is its ability to define and sculpt facial features. With the right application, you can create the illusion of higher cheekbones and a slimmer nose.

2. Long-lasting Finish

Unlike cream contours, which can sometimes wear off throughout the day, contour face powders typically offer a more long-lasting finish. This ensures your makeup looks fresh from morning to night.

3. Buildable Coverage

Most contour powders are buildable, allowing you to customize the intensity of your contour. Whether you prefer a subtle definition or a bold look, contour face powders can be layered to achieve your desired effect.

How to Choose the Right Contour Face Powder

1. Skin Tone Matching

Selecting the right shade is crucial. For light skin tones, opt for cool taupes or soft browns. Medium skin can benefit from a neutral taupe, while deeper skin tones should choose rich browns or warm shades.

2. Texture Matters

Contour face powders come in various textures, including matte and shimmer. Matte formulas are ideal for a natural look, while shimmer powders can add a glamorous touch for special occasions.

Application Tips for Contour Face Powder

1. Prep Your Skin

Always start with a clean, well-moisturized face. A primer can also help create a smooth canvas for makeup application.

2. Use the Right Tools

Investing in good brushes can significantly improve your contouring efforts. A small, angled brush is excellent for precise application, while a fluffier brush works well for blending.

3. Know Where to Apply

Common areas for contouring include the hollows of the cheeks, along the jawline, and the sides of the nose. Make sure to blend well to avoid harsh lines.
